Product Overview
The Ciena 280-0154-00 is a 10Gb/s XFP transceiver designed for long-haul DWDM applications. It supports transmission up to 80km over single-mode fiber and operates at a wavelength of 1529.55nm, using an LC duplex connector.

Product Description
This Ciena XFP transceiver module, part number 280-0154-00, is engineered for high-speed networking, specifically for 10 Gigabit Ethernet (10GbE) deployments within Dense Wavelength Division Multiplexing (DWDM) systems. It provides a robust solution for extending network connectivity over long distances, supporting up to 80 kilometers of single-mode fiber. The specific operating wavelength of 1529.55nm is crucial for integration into DWDM systems, allowing for precise channel allocation. The XFP (10 Gigabit Small Form Factor Pluggable) form factor ensures that the module is hot-pluggable, facilitating easy installation and replacement without interrupting network operations. It utilizes an LC duplex connector, which is the industry standard for fiber optic connections, offering a secure and reliable physical interface. The module's design is optimized for performance and reliability in demanding network environments. Ciena is a recognized leader in optical networking, and this transceiver reflects their commitment to quality and innovation. The 80km reach capability makes it suitable for backbone, metro, and long-haul network applications where high bandwidth and extended reach are essential. Its compatibility with single-mode fiber ensures minimal signal loss and maximum data integrity over the specified distance, making it a key component for modern optical networks.
